💨
Non-Viable Spore Trap Air Sampling
Spore trap cassettes collect airborne particles that are then analyzed under microscopy to identify mold genera and count spore concentrations. Compared against an outdoor baseline sample, this data shows whether indoor spore counts are elevated and which genera are present. Fastest turnaround for routine Saint Paul, MN air quality assessment.
🏭
Viable Culture Air Sampling
Culture plates capture live, culturable mold spores that then grow in the lab — allowing species-level identification and colony-forming unit counts. Used when species-level data matters: occupational health concerns, Stachybotrys investigation, or situations where genus-level data from spore traps isn't sufficient for your Saint Paul, MN use case.
🎖
Surface Swab & Tape Lift Sampling
Surface samples collected from visible growth areas — swabs for culture analysis or tape lifts for direct microscopy — identify the species present on specific surfaces. Used to confirm whether visible staining is mold and which genus/species is involved before committing to remediation scope.

🏢
HVAC & Ductwork Air Testing
Testing at HVAC registers and returns identifies whether the air distribution system is a mold source. High spore counts at registers compared to room-level samples indicate the system is contributing to indoor air quality problems — a critical finding before any duct cleaning or coil remediation decision in Saint Paul.
🔋
Bulk & ERMI Sampling
Bulk material samples and ERMI (Environmental Relative Moldiness Index) floor dust sampling give a cumulative picture of historical mold presence in a Saint Paul, MN property. ERMI uses qPCR analysis on settled dust to identify 36 mold species — often used in post-remediation verification or occupant health investigations.

Both methods are valid — they answer different questions. Spore traps give fast, total-count data by genus. Cultures give species-level data on live organisms. For most Saint Paul residential testing, spore trap sampling is the right starting point. Cultures are used when genus-level data isn't enough for your specific use case.
Minimum for a meaningful result is two indoor plus one outdoor comparative. Most Saint Paul residential tests involve three to five total samples. Commercial properties and multi-unit buildings require more. We scope the sampling protocol based on your specific situation — not a default package.
Consumer test kits detect presence — not concentration, not species, not comparison to outdoor baseline. They're not accepted by insurance carriers, real estate attorneys, or courts. For any situation where results need to stand up to scrutiny, professional accredited-lab testing in Saint Paul, MN is the only meaningful option.
Non-viable spore trap results from our accredited lab partner typically return within 24–48 hours of sample receipt by the lab. We ship samples same-day in most cases. Viable culture results take 5–7 business days. Your written report is compiled and delivered upon receipt of lab results — so for standard spore trap testing, most Saint Paul clients have their written report within 3–5 business days of the sampling appointment.
If you already have confirmed visible mold growth of significant extent, testing isn't always necessary before beginning remediation — what's there needs to go regardless. Testing is most valuable when: (1) you suspect mold but can't confirm it visually, (2) occupants have health symptoms without an identified source, (3) you're buying or selling a property and need documentation, or (4) you need to verify that remediation was completed successfully.
